Before you purchase a HUD, you will need to know about the following things:

  • Types of HUDs

There are two types of HUDs in the market which you will have to choose from: model that is Smartphone supporting and model that is OBD2 port supporting.

  • OBD2 HUD: It has the capacity to connect directly to your car and display the information on the windshield of your vehicle. The display that you will be able to see includes engine speed, vehicle speed, battery level, temperature, and in the process, warn you on any faults and errors about your vehicle. You will get various products and features that are available for this type of HUDs,
  • Smartphone HUD: It is a model that can easily pair with your phone to be able to display notifications of your phone, answer calls handsfree and navigate on your phone screen. depending on the particular features and the technology used, these HUDs tend to be more expensive as compared to the OBD2 HUDs. It is a device that will communicate together with your mobile phone through Bluetooth and display the screen of the phone, notifications and maps, together with other information.

Essential parameters of HUDs

The HUD has the capability to display all the information which a driver needs to be displayed on the windshield using a projected display. The information is important and includes fuel level, speed of the vehicle, engine check and data about the oil, direction in which the vehicle is currently moving, engine speed, altitude, battery voltage, water temperature, average fuel consumption, instantaneous fuel consumption, and mileage measurement just to mention but a few.

With a display that has a setting that is customized, you can always limit the type of information that you want to be displayed on the windshield. On a normal count, a HUD comes with an HD display of about 5.5 inches so that you can get the best experience when viewing.

Will the HUD work with your vehicle?

Any HUD which has an onboard diagnostic (OBD2 type) that is enabled, will work with any vehicle that has an interface of OBD2. How will you be able to know that your vehicle is OBD2 enabled? Just open your car engine hood and get the sticker which indicates if the vehicle is compliant with the OBD software.

Connecting the Head-up display

It is very simple to set up a HUD to your vehicle as you will just have to plug it directly into the connector of the OBD2 that you will find near the driver’s seat. The OBD2 cable that comes with the HUD is strong enough and has enough length to reach the interface of the OBD2.

Most of the HUDs work with a plug and play interface and get its power from the OBD2 connector. Once you are done with the connecting and turning on the device, the car will send all the necessary data automatically to the HUD device through the connector of the OBD2 and the project of the HUD display on the screen onto the vehicle windshield.
